Type
ORACLE
Validation date
2025-07-19 14:54: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.625e-4,
    "usd": 3.053e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00014981D2C0C1C339388463705E25235247D15982D9F159A0008D0C180B28B7A279

Previous signature

C24614D3C128E95956B0C58D98E4C698B5774878FA75036FE80C636D2FA209BD0C79677598C85CE1C762C43FBD7BD6883DE4727124FE921AA9DAD1C22C28C90D

Origin signature

30440220229F6ACAE671FBFBF30D7A8665F360652972593B255EB137B275FED1F4AA585A02203EA14482C50F4BA29C582619569DF97D0D97ABCD43F270EA8C7279FDD18F20EA

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00771F0766721787DE0601096C90B952C979422FE1CBAC9F19C53C179CC9B2E0E9

Coordinator signature

C8EB75E10C51CE19096A1C82384627D603409728C0C2367313ED99124C1D02126313EA66DEE0645D36B303DCEE86F4572B3E637251864BC5EFF1BE32662A2D01

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

1E9BA1A864AA7EE9469DCD008E1B0FA0BA66B8D70C2E2844AE81F6AADA40927978D2AA37F9B17112DB42D4C5F1C708359C83A65EDBE7084698E02A38ADD41603

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

55F4E9E3EF059515BB4418D442FC303F4A4835183B7181830E6EEF6BC2C0C2153EBBC0BC61A6FDCC3F60727E126C37EE90F0D5388A95AA3002BC3E2E1383DC0A